Sarangpura is a small village of 182 hectares in Bamanwas Tehsil in Sawai Madhopur district, also known for Ranthambore National Park in the State of Rajasthan, India.[2] The village is administrated by a sarpanch who is elected representative of the village by the local elections. Sarangpura depends on GANGAPUR CITY, the nearest town for all major economic activities.[3] The village has government-provided water facilities that include Two taps, One Well supply, Two tanks, Two tubewells, and One handpump. The villagers also acquire water from some of the natural water sources - Two rivers, Two canals and Two springs. Sarangpura is also surrounded by Two lakes. The population of the village depends on the source of drinking water during summer on Handpump. Sarangpura's pin code is 322201[4], and village code is 01279700. The area of Sarangpura is segregated as 26.77 hectares irrigated area, 91.41 hectares unirrigated, the 64 hectare area under culturable waste (including gauchar and groves), and remaining 0.3 hectare area not available for cultivation.

Sarangpura has Two banks and Two credit societies for the regulation of economic activity. The village is also equipped with Two recreational centers.

The village has an uninterrupted 24 hours electric supply from a power grid.

Demographics

Sarangpura is a census village in the district of Sawai Madhopur, Rajasthan. The village has a total population of 289 and has total administration over 55 houses which are connected to supplies basic amenities like water and sewerage.

  • Sarangpura has 29 children, 15 boys and 14 girls.
  • Scheduled caste counts for 39 (13.49%) males constitute 23 (7.96%) of the population and females 16 (5.54%).
  • Scheduled tribe counts for 229 (79.24%) males constitute 124 (42.91%) of the population and females 105 (36.33%).

Educational institutions

As per the census 2011 report, 192 people are literate in Sarangpura out of which 132 are males and 60 are females.

Sarangpura has the following educational facilities:

  • 1 Education facility
  • 1 Primary school
  • 3 Colleges in the nearby range
  • 1 Adult literacy center

Employment

According to a census 2011 report, 159 people of the total population are employed. The workforce is 89 male, 70 female with 92 (57.86%) of all workers being employed full-time, this includes 74 males and 18 females. 62 males and 17 females are considered as the main cultivators with the help of 3 male and 1 female agricultural labor. 67 people are reported to work for a marginal period of time in the year.

They depend on the agricultural markets (Mandi) of the nearby towns of GANGAPUR CITY and Sawai Madhopur to sell earthen pot and make their living.
